M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S
Education: Graduation
from an accredited high school or possession of a high school equivalency
certificate.
Experience: One year of
experience in the operation of data entry devices.
Notes:
1. Specialized,
documented training in data processing may substitute for six months of the
required experience.
2. General clerical
experience may substitute on a year-for-year basis for the required education.
General clerical experience is defined as work performing a variety of clerical
duties which are clear-cut and typically found in office settings, such as
filing, copying, posting data and directing telephone calls.
3. Candidates may substitute U.S. Armed
Forces military service experience as a non-commissioned officer in Computer
Clerk and Assistant classifications or Computer Clerk and Assistant specialty
codes in the General, Administrative, Clerical, and Office Services field of
work on a year-for-year basis for the required experience.

SPECIAL REQUIREMENTS
1. Employees in this classification are required to be registered voters in the State of Maryland in accordance with the Election Law Article, Section 2-207(d).
2. Employees in this classification may not hold or be a candidate for any elective public or political party office or any other office created under the Constitution or laws of this State in accordance with the Election Law Article, Section 2-301(b).
